Output 862d298e6eaa145e2f4e1e666c53f259de20fb3099b0fe23517af7e6277d8222:153

value
113514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a4ae3ba53b4c5cee3b3d383cfa6a803cd5a0628 OP_EQUAL
address
32dSPszhqaty7GZ3V6EyF8wqY9TFkq38qg
transaction
862d298e6eaa145e2f4e1e666c53f259de20fb3099b0fe23517af7e6277d8222